Replacement Double Glazed Windows Near Me

Getting replacement double glazed windows near me is a good investment in the long-term value of your home. A variety of factors could impact the overall cost, such as frame material and window style.

JELD-WEN Siteline Wood and Clad-Wood windows offer elegant design, thoughtful engineering and energy efficiency. They are constructed with AuraLast pine, which protects against harsh weather wood rot and water damage.

Wooden windows are timeless and inexpensive. They are a good insulator and require minimal maintenance to maintain their appearance. They are not as durable, however, as vinyl or aluminium. They are susceptible to condensation, which can cause decay and mold and are susceptible to water damage from rain or storms. They are also not as efficient in energy use as other materials and their frames may expand and contract as the weather changes.

JELD-WEN's Siteline wood and clad-wood windows display elegant design and thoughtful engineering and their cladding is high-performance and protects the wood from termites wood rot and extreme weather. They are available in a variety of colors and finishes for the exterior and interior to match your home, from bright whites to rustic fruitwood. They can be used in various architectural styles, ranging from modern to historic.

Although they aren't as durable as wood, aluminum and vinyl windows do not require to be painted or stained and are among the most affordable options for replacing windows. They are a great insulator and are very easy to maintain. These windows are often sold with a vinyl or aluminum cladding that mimics the look of painted wood.

Fiberglass is a mid-priced alternative that is as durable as aluminum and as energy-efficient as vinyl. It can be painted to resemble wood and comes in a variety of colors.

Wooden sash windows are the most classic, but they tend to leak air and allow cold wind through in winter and hot air out in summer. They can be difficult to open and close. If you have windows made of wood secondary glazing is the most cost-effective choice. It's about PS300 for each window and can save you up to PS50 per year on energy bills.

uPVC replacements are usually the least expensive option. The quality of uPVC isn't always the same, so it's best to choose a reliable company that has a warranty for their products. To avoid uPVC problems, choose a product with thick walls or pockets with multiple pockets. These features prevent the window from warping over time and will increase its energy efficiency.

Pella's Encompass Series vinyl windows are an affordable option that conforms to the ENERGY STAR standards. These windows feature high-quality fade-resistant vinyl and are available in three frame colors. They are available in double-hung and single-hung window styles and sliding windows.

Milgard's Tuscany Series premium vinyl windows are another budget-friendly choice. The windows have a classic appearance that can be enhanced with nine different colors. They are available in single-hung, double-hung slider, casement picture, awning, and radius windows.

Andersen's 400 Series vinyl and wood windows are a mid-range option for new construction or window Replacement Double Glazed window. This series features a variety of vinyl colors and six different types of wood. The window glass is customizable to meet the specific requirements of the customer.

Timber-framed replacement windows are the most costly option, but they can provide real value to your home and can be made from both hardwood and softwood. They can be painted to match the house style or matched with trims already in place. If you are planning to install windows made of timber, make sure to have them professionally installed by a contractor with experience. This will minimize the chance of unexpected glitches during the installation process and ensure that the work is completed properly.

Fiberglass

Pultrusion is a process that is used to make fiberglass doors and windows. This automated process involves pultrusion, which is the process of pulling lengths of fiberglass strand mat or roving through heated dies. The material is then hardened into long rods and long strips called "lineals". Lineals are then screwed with hidden corner blocks that are reinforced with nylon to form strong, tight joints. The exterior and interior coatings are applied to the windows and doors to provide durability, aesthetics and weather resistance.

These windows are an excellent choice for homeowners who want to improve the appearance of their home with an energy-efficient upgrade. They are available in a range of finishes and colors, and are easy to maintain. They are also resistant to rot, mold and swelling. The composite material used to manufacture the windows and doors provides superior strength and low moisture absorption. It also withstands temperature fluctuations.

Aluminum

A double-pane window is comprised of two panes of insulated glass that are sealed as a complete unit. They are a popular choice for homeowners looking to reduce their energy costs and insulate against extreme temperatures, noise, and other environmental elements. The space between the glass is filled with either gas argon or krypton, which creates an air barrier and prevents heat transfer. In addition to the type of glass the frame material and design can also influence the windows overall energy usage and the labeling.

There are a variety of options to replace double-pane windows. You can either replace the entire frame or only the IGU panel inside the frame. This option is less expensive, however it may not provide the same energy efficiency as a brand Replacement double glazed window new window.

The line of JELD-WEN's aluminum replacement windows is designed for the harsh climate conditions that prevail in Florida and the Gulf Coast*. These energy efficient windows feature aluminum cladding for strength, low maintenance and superior weather resistance. In addition the glazed areas feature laminated glass and Low-E coatings for better thermal efficiency.

Although single-paned windows can be used, it is recommended to purchase double glazing. This will not just make your home more comfortable but also lower your cooling and heating costs. According to a study conducted by the Energy Saving Trust, homeowners who install double-glazing may save up to PS160 per year.

If your double pane windows are damaged, a professional can assist you in determining whether it is more cost-effective to fix or replace the entire window. A technician with the right abilities can also give you advice on the most appropriate frames and glazing options for your house.

The cost of purchasing and installing replacement windows is determined by the frame and glazing material you select. It is crucial to take into account all factors when making this choice. You'll need to think about frame and glazing materials along with glass and glazing options gas fills and spacers and how the window will operate. It is also important to consider any possible rebates or promotions that window companies offer or installation contractors.
